You don't give any details of the two most important factors: mileage and service history. It would be a bit of a stab in the dark without knowing this. Also number of owners?

Assuming average mileage an N 1995 and forgetting any extras www.parkers.co.uk reckon 5,500 trade in/part ex and 6,500 private sale.
